Home News SolidFire: SSD Offers Huge Performance Boost to MongoDB By July 8, 2014 SolidFire’s all-SSD storage solutions provide performance boosts of more than 200 percent for MongoDB NoSQL deployments, according to Yahoo benchmarking.
